BE and SEP Liveupdate Policies, Who Wins?

Here's a question for anyone out there.  We have a Backup Exec server set to not update the software automatically.  We have SEP installed and the policy is currently set to update automatically.  Who wins?  Will the SEP software rules over-rule BE and force BE to update to whatever patches and service packs are available or will BE win and no updates will occur?  Or, as I suspect, each product behaves independantly and they update according to their individual settings?  Any help or reference would be greatly appreciated.

I would suggest to opt out Backup Exec from other LiveUpdate sessions such as that of SEP...

From the command prompt, change directory to Installed Drive\Program files\symantec\backup exec

run the following command

beupdateops.exe -addbe -optout
